Service Description
Origami transforms paper into an exquisite piece of craft. It creates something you can display, present as a gift, or simply duplicate to perfection. More importantly, origami can teach "life lessons" such as patience, focus, humility and acceptance. If you've ever marveled at how a small, single piece of paper can be transformed into spectacular shapes, this class may be your ticket to hours of enjoyment and creativity. Along the way, we will learn a bit of history, how to fold and crease, and to bend paper into friendly animals, geometric shapes, and unique pride-worthy crafts. No experience preferred! Supplies provided in registration: small paper square, and printed directions with 3-D diagrams. Jim will offer detailed personal instruction and time to practice. Homework optional. Location will be sent to registrants. Class limited to 8 participants. Folder (and RECCS U Founder) Jim Brickey became fascinated with origami 12 years ago when a friend gave him 1,000 paper cranes. Though not a true artist, Jim is proficient, enjoys folding paper and helping others create origami shapes.
